#150cfd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#150cfd is composed of 8.2% red, 4.7% green and 99.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 91.7% cyan, 95.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 0.8% black. It has a hue angle of 242.2 degrees, a saturation of 98.4% and a lightness of 52%. #150cfd color hex could be obtained by blending #2a18ff with #0000fb. Closest websafe color is: #0000ff.

#150cfd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#150cfd has RGB values of R:21, G:12, B:253 and CMYK values of C:0.92,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.01. Its decimal value is 1379581.

Hex triplet 150cfd #150cfd
RGB Decimal 21, 12, 253 rgb(21,12,253)
RGB Percent 8.2, 4.7, 99.2 rgb(8.2%,4.7%,99.2%)
CMYK 92, 95, 0, 1
HSL 242.2°, 98.4, 52 hsl(242.2,98.4%,52%)
HSV (or HSB) 242.2°, 95.3, 99.2
Web Safe 0000ff #0000ff
CIE-LAB 32.947, 77.038, -105.651
XYZ 18.167, 7.513, 93.416
xyY 0.153, 0.063, 7.513
CIE-LCH 32.947, 130.755, 306.099
CIE-LUV 32.947, -9.029, -130.148
Hunter-Lab 27.41, 70.342, -182.882
Binary 00010101, 00001100, 11111101

Shades and Tints of #150cfd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#00000a is the darkest color, while #f6f5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#150cfd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7d8c is the less saturated color, while #150cfd is the most saturated one.
